1. A method for transmission via circuitry of first and second three-dimensional (3D) images, each 3D image having first and second two-dimensional (2D) images, the method comprising:

  • operating a decimator circuit for segmenting the first and second 3D images with a ratio of 2, the segmenting comprisingremoving lines of a first parity in the first 2D image of the first 3D image,removing lines of a second parity in the second 2D image of the first 3D image,removing lines of the second parity in the first 2D image of the second 3D image, andremoving lines of the first parity in the second 2D image of the second 3D image;

    assembling the segmented first and second 3D images into a pair of composite images;

    transmitting the pair of composite images; and

    operating a de-interlace circuit for reconstructing the first and second 3D images from the pair of composite images, the reconstructing comprisingkeeping information removed during the segmenting of the first 2D image of the first 3D image from a spatial point of view in the first 2D image of the second 3D image,keeping information removed during the segmenting of the second 2D image of the first 3D image from the spatial point of view in the second 2D image of the second 3D image, andreconstructing the first and second 3D images by de-interlacing the pair of composite images.
